According to dermatologist Cristiane Simões, hidradenitis suppurativa consists of a chronic disease that is difficult to manage. “Sometimes it causes extreme frustration in patients who are affected by it due to the recurrence of lesions. And also in doctors, who often need to change therapies during clinical follow-up, ”she says.

 

Also called acne inversa, this condition still generates controversy in the medical community, as its causes are not fully known. Its origin is believed to be inflammation or infection of the sweat glands. In addition, there are already studies that point to hair follicles as the source of the initial process.
